173 CATERPILLAR SIGN: NOVEL ENDOSCOPIC FINDING IN PATIENTS WITH EOSINOPHILIC ESOPHAGITIS

Pathological identification of esophageal eosinophilia (EE) is considered to be most important and critical step for diagnosis of eosinophilic esophagitis (EoE). Although several endoscopic findings related with EoE have been reported, it is still difficult to exclude other causes of EE, such as gastroesophageal reflux disease. Here, we noted a novel endoscopic finding related with EoE termed ‘Caterpillar sign’. The aim of this study was to evaluate its clinical significance for the diagnosis of EoE. Methods One hundred and seventy-four patients who were endoscopically suspected with EoE at our hospital and affiliated institutions were enrolled. EoE was defined clinically by symptoms of esophageal dysfunction and histologically by the presence of EE [≧15 eosinophils/high power field (HPF)]. Endoscopic findings at baseline were retrospectively reviewed. ‘Caterpillar sign’ was defined as a stair-like, fragile, slight mucosal protruded lesion sandwiched between longitudinal furrows, such as the Caterpillar traces remaining on the ground (Figure). Furthermore, the clinicopathological features of patients having ‘Caterpillar sign’ were evaluated. Results One hundred and seventy-four patients (92 males, 82 females with mean age of 49.7) suspected with EoE were evaluated, of whom 60 (34.5%) was finally diagnosed as EoE. ‘Caterpillar sign’ was found in 48 patients (80.0%). Sensitivity and Specificity of ‘Caterpillar sign’ for the diagnosis of EoE was 0.80 (95% confidence interval [CI] 0.72–0.85) and 0.94 (95% CI 0.90–0.97), respectively. Furthermore, the presence of ‘Caterpillar sign’ was associated with degree of eosinophil infiltration (Caterpillar sign positive: 42.9 ± 49.3/HPF vs. Caterpillar sign negative: 6.7 ± 24.4/HPF, p < 0.0001). Conclusion This novel finding termed ‘Caterpillar sign’ was clinically useful for the definitive diagnosis of EoE and associated with degree of eosinophil infiltration.

173 毛虫体征:嗜酸性食管炎患者的新内镜检查结果

食管嗜酸性粒细胞增多症(EE)的病理鉴定被认为是诊断嗜酸性粒细胞性食管炎(EoE)最重要和最关键的步骤。尽管已经报道了一些与 EoE 相关的内镜检查结果,但仍然难以排除 EE 的其他原因,例如胃食管反流病。在这里,我们注意到与 EoE 相关的一种新的内窥镜发现,称为“毛毛虫征”。本研究的目的是评估其对 EoE 诊断的临床意义。方法 纳入我院及附属机构内镜下疑似EoE患者174例。EoE 在临床上由食管功能障碍的症状定义,在组织学上由 EE [≥15 个嗜酸性粒细胞/高倍视野 (HPF)] 的存在定义。回顾性回顾了基线的内窥镜检查结果。“毛毛虫征”被定义为夹在纵向沟之间的阶梯状、易碎、轻微黏膜突出病变,例如残留在地面上的毛毛虫痕迹(图)。此外,评估了具有“毛毛虫征”的患者的临床病理学特征。结果 对疑似 EoE 的 174 例患者(男 92 例,女 82 例,平均年龄 49.7 岁)进行了评估,最终诊断为 EoE 患者 60 例(34.5%)。在 48 名患者 (80.0%) 中发现了“毛毛虫征”。“毛虫征”对 EoE 诊断的敏感性和特异性分别为 0.80(95% 置信区间 [CI] 0.72–0.85)和 0.94(95% CI 0.90–0.97)。此外,“Caterpillar 征”的存在与嗜酸性粒细胞浸润程度相关(Caterpillar 征阳性:42.9 ± 49.3/HPF 与 Caterpillar 征阴性:6.7 ± 24.4/HPF,p < 0.0001)。结论 这一被称为“毛毛虫征”的新发现在临床上可用于明确诊断 EoE,并与嗜酸性粒细胞浸润程度相关。
